Referring to the configuration of the present invention for achieving the above object in detail as follows.

The present invention in the antibacterial functional Hanji wallpaper mixed with cypress leaves and functional minerals,

As a bast fiber with good viscosity and cohesion of fiber, wood pulp 25% (weight ratio) is mixed with 60% (weight ratio) of beaten fibrous natural pulp which is a natural Korean paper stock to form a beaten pulp-like mixed stock, and the pulp again 3% (weight ratio) of unrefined biotite powder (germanium) with a particle size of 320 mesh and 5% (weight ratio) of powdered mulberry powder in the form of nano-size ultra-fine particles of 20 µm or less were mixed with the phase-mixing powder, respectively. Add 5% epoxy resin (weight ratio) and 2% (weight ratio) of vegetable natural adhesive, which is harmless to the human body, as a strength enhancer, respectively, to form a functional material mixture stock, and then put it in a heating container and heat it for 30 minutes at a temperature of 80 ° C. Pulverized pulverized extract of finely pulverized leaves with a diameter of less than 1 mm, and extracted at a ratio of 5: 1 (weight ratio) compared to the functional material mixture stock, and added raw cypress leaves. To make natural pattern by tangling pulp, cypress extract and green leaf of cypress, mixed paper with long and short paper machine and drying with far-infrared dryer under temperature condition of 100 ℃ ~ 130 ℃ to prevent tearing or damage. It is characterized by forming antibacterial functional Hanji wallpaper, which is formed and mixed with cypress leaves and functional minerals on sheets having morphological stability and durability.

Phytoncide is a substance that plants exhale or secrete against resistance to pathogens, pests, and fungi. Drinking phytoncide through a forest bath is known to relieve stress, strengthen intestinal and cardiopulmonary functions, and sterilize. Phenolic compounds including terpene, which are constituents of phytoncide, alkaloids, and glycosides, especially terpenes among the phytoncide components function as bactericides and preservatives by killing bacteria, fungi, parasites, insects, etc. It is volatile and liquefied, so it can be inhaled deep into the body, and because of its low toxicity, it has no side effects, so it is known for its excellent value. Especially, phytoncide emitted from cypress is the blood concentration of cortisol, a stress hormone. Less than half Enhance the immune system of the person and is effective to cure atopic dermatitis.

Example 1

1. Formation of functional material mixture stock

60% by weight of wood pulp (weight ratio) of the beaten fibrous paper pulp was mixed to form a beaten pulp-like mixed stock, and again pulverized to a particle size of 320 mesh as a composite raw material powder on the pulp-like mixed stock. 5% (weight ratio) of powdered biotite (germanium) and 5% (weight ratio) powdered mulberry powder in nano-sized ultra-fine particles of 20 µm or less, respectively, and 5% epoxy resin (weight ratio) and intelligence enhancer 2% (by weight) of the harmless vegetable natural adhesive was mixed to form a functional material mixture stock.

2. Cypress Leaf Extract

The cypress leaves were put in a heating vessel and cooked at a temperature of 80 ° C. for 30 minutes, finely pulverized to less than 1 mm in diameter, and chopped to obtain a cypress leaf extract.

3. Cutting Cypress Leaves

The washed cypress leaves were cut to size.

4. Manufacturing of paper-cut functional Korean paper wallpaper mixed with cypress leaves and functional materials

A natural pattern is realized by mixing lychee cypress leaf extract in a ratio of 5: 1 (weight ratio) compared to the functional material mixture stock formed by adding chopped raw cypress leaves and naturally entangled with pulping pulp, cypress extract and cypress leaves. The blended paper was made with a long-term paper machine and dried in a far-infrared dryer at a temperature of 100 ° C. to 130 ° C. to prepare a functional paper wallpaper mixed with cypress leaves and functional minerals.

As a result of the construction and volatilization of the antimicrobial functional Hanji wallpaper of the present invention formed in this way, it was confirmed that the fragrance of the cypress phytoncide was appropriately and softly radiated without being too strong at an early stage.
